Route Small Cyclades and Mikonos from Paros, Greece - ID 399

Day 1: Check-in

Welcome on board at Paros port at 18.00. A day to mingle and get to know each other a bit better, before starting your sailing adventure early tomorrow morning. Once aboard, you will take your place in your cabin and follow the safety briefing. In the evening, you will have free time to have dinner in a typical Greek restaurant on the waterfront, before ending the evening in one of the many bars that populate this island.

Day 2

We leave Paros and sail south to Antiparos island, for our first swim and our overnight stop. Beautiful beaches, vibrant bars, and cozy restaurants are within walking distance from the port.

Day 3

Early morning departure with a course to reach the Blue Lagoon south of Paros, for a morning swim. Following a short stop at Paros, we are heading to Alimia bay, an ideal spot to snorkel around & have lunch onboard. Arrival to the authentic island of Iraklia late afternoon.

Day 4

A relaxed sail to Schinoussa is today’s plan, where we will be dropping anchor for swimming and lunch, in one of its numerous coves. We will depart towards Koufonissia, where we expect to arrive before 17:00 for overnight stop.

Day 5

Today we will sail to Naxos and its beautiful harbour, once there you will have the opportunity to visit the beautiful old Venetian town and the sublime cuisine of the typical Greek tavernas. In the afternoon, after lunch, we will hoist the sails heading north and depending on the weather conditions we will reach Mykonos, also known as the island of the winds as it is characterised by the Meltemi wind that blows in this part of Greece.

Day 6

Today we will spend the day in beautiful Mykonos, in the heart of the Cyclades. World-famous as a cosmopolitan holiday destination, with clubs to party in by day and by night, this island has so much more to offer: a hidden, more picturesque side, with stone-paved alleys, whitewashed houses, country chapels and windmills, exuding calm and peace. In the late afternoon we return to the embarkation marina in Paros.

Day 7: Check-out

Disembarkation is scheduled for 09.00 in the morning.

Route Western Cyclades and Santorini from Paros, Greece - ID 399

Day 1: Check-in

Welcome on board at Paros Marina at 3 pm. A quick departure for a late afternoon sailing will take us to the island of Ios, where we will be spending the night. Have the chance to stroll around and explore the island’s famous nightlife.

Day 2

A long leg of sailing is planned for today, that will take us to Santorini island and Ammoudi bay by 13:00. A quick drop off for you to explore the island, will be arranged, while the boat stays on anchor waiting for your return. Be ready, by 20:00 to re-embark from Ammoudi e enjoy the sunset while our crew will be anchoring at Thirasia island.

Day 3

Morning breakfast and setting course to our next destination, the island of Folegandros. Arrival in the afternoon after 4.5 hours of sailing, yet longing to visit “Chora”, the capital of the island, for romantic walks and majestic sunset views from up high!

Day 4

The island of Kimolos is today’s destination, with its friendly and relaxed atmosphere along with beautiful coves and waters, ideal for swimming. Before reaching Kimolos harbour a lunch stop at Polyaigos is a must on this route.

Day 5

A relaxed and short sailing for today to the famous island of Milos. Before reaching the port, we will be stopping in the entrance of Milos’s natural harbor Adamas, for our daily swim stop, where lunch will be served.

Day 6

Today we will be sailing towards the south of Sifnos, the final destination of our sailing trip, if weather permits. Expected to arrive by noon in the sheltered bays of southern Sifnos, where we will be having lunch. The planned port of call for your last night onboard is Platys Gialos, a beautiful bay with many options to dine and drink.

Day 7: Check-out

Last day today, starting with breakfast in the port, and later setting sail to the north of Antiparos, which is the chosen spot for some swimming and lunch. Departure around 16:00, for our final leg to the port of Parikia in Paros and check-out at 7 pm.
